Transaction 530a58fbc51f01bf45b3c30f369b34202c96744573bca195499380b64b2efe9c
1 Input
1 Output
-
530a58fbc51f01bf45b3c30f369b34202c96744573bca195499380b64b2efe9c:0
- value
- 27604646
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 312aca4368619ebf8f4a9c0bdf856263e55b4f54798aacc443a3aed9c59484c2
- address
- bc1pxy4v5smgvx0tlr62ns9alptzv0j4kn650x92e3zr5whdn3v5snpq5z836v